Memcached Configuration

Memcached exposes its main server configuration and a dedicated directory for application private keys through the platform configuration file manager. These files can be edited or uploaded directly from the dashboard.
CONF Main Memcached configuration file: /etc/sysconfig/memcached
KEYS Private-key storage directory: /var/lib/jelastic/keys

CONF — Memcached Configuration

The main Memcached configuration file is available inside the conf folder. Use this file to manage the server settings exposed by the platform.

The underlying file represented by the memcached item is located at /etc/sysconfig/memcached.

Configuration changes: Edit only parameters you understand and validate the Memcached service after making changes. Incorrect values can prevent the cache service from starting or accepting application connections.

KEYS — Private Key Storage

The keys directory is intended for private-key files required by your application or integration.

  • Generate the required private key.
  • Save it as a regular file.
  • Upload the file into the keys folder using the configuration file manager.
  • Reference the uploaded key by its filesystem path from your application or configuration.

The key path uses the following format:

/var/lib/jelastic/keys/{key_file_name}

Key security: Treat uploaded private keys as sensitive credentials. Restrict access, do not expose key contents in application logs or public repositories, and reference them only from trusted application configuration.
